Anyone think it's possible for TDK to pull defeat from the jaws of victory at this point and end up missing the OW record? Right now according to Mase, it's sitting at 113.78M needing 37.34M on Sunday to reach the record $115.11M. With all the front loading and people flocking to see it as soon as possible having gone to theaters already, could it have a Sunday drop big enough to fall a tiny bit short? Just curious.

Not gonna happen. Just saw the numbers, and anything better than a 27.6% drop for TDK on Sunday means it has the OW record. Which is going to be easy if the 17% drop they are predicting is anywhere near close. Unless they overpredicted by 10% on Sunday, i'd say congrats to TDK.

Spider-Man 3 dropped 62% in week two, but that was due to bad word-of-mouth. Dead Man's Chest dropped 54% in week two. My prediction is in line with Dead Man's Chest but a few points lower due to the excellent word-of-mouth. If it's really lucky, you could see a drop in line with Batman Begins, the first Spider-Man or Shrek 2. (Why didn't Wall-E hold like Shrek 2? This easily shows the decline of animation in which even stars pack more in than quality.)
